Saturday, June 27, 2009

Mama Palmas : Philadelphia

The herbed sausage and artichoke hearts pizza take out was **really** salty. The combination of salty sausage and salty artichoke hearts really detracted from what could have been a slightly better than average pizza.

I don't think I'll be going back any time soon, but apparently the polenta bread was something we should have tried. One other note is that apparently, others have in the past have received down-right rude service eating there. Not sure if this is the case any more.

Mama Palmas
2229 Spruce St Philadelphia, PA 19103 (Map)
(215) 735-7357


  1. John again ... have you tried L'Angolo Ristorante Italiano on Porter Street? Great BYOB ...

  2. Hey John, I haven't had the chance to try it out yet, but will mark it down as a to-try. Strangely, I haven't really tried many of the Italian restaurants in Philly, despite this town being known for its solid Italian cuisine.